Three months ahead of the US midterms, US President Donald Trump gave a half-hour speech laden with unproven claims regarding election fraud, regarding the security of elections in the country and repeating misinformation regarding fraud back in 2020. In a televised address on Thursday, the US president contested, once again, the 2020 US presidential election results, referencing a so-called 'deep state' that allegedly hid evidence of Chinese meddling.

France 24 English reported the story as "US media split on airing Trump's speech heavy with unproven claims." The Guardian US reported the story as "DHS chief threatens states that refuse Trump’s election demands after president’s widely condemned speech."
